Milner House is a residential care home in Rugby, West Midlands, operated by New Directions (Rugby) Limited since 2011. The home has 3 beds and is rated Good by the national care regulator. The home specialises in dementia care, including support for Alzheimer's, vascular dementia, Lewy body dementia.

What to test on your visit

Use this short field guide at Milner House to turn public clues into practical in-person checks.

What to test on your visit to Milner House

  1. 1What has changed since the last inspection, and what would look different if the home were inspected again now?
  2. 2How do you support residents who wander or become distressed in practice?
  3. 3Who leads day to day on this floor, and how long have they been in post?
  • Is the latest inspection report visible in reception?

    Confirms transparency on current quality.

  • What are staffing levels on day and night shifts?

    Shows whether support is consistent around the clock.

  • How are families updated when needs change?

    Communication is usually a top concern for relatives.

  • Can we see an example care plan review timeline?

    Helps confirm how quickly the team adapts care.

  • May we speak with a current resident family member?

    Gives an independent perspective before deciding.
